How it works

Think of calcium as a structural builder for your skeleton. It supports bone mineralization and helps maintain bone density. Beyond your bones, calcium also plays a critical role in neuromuscular relaxation, helping your muscles relax and your nerves signal properly [NIH ODS].

Safety profile

The FDA has received a total of 592,059 adverse event reports across all supplements. For calcium specifically, high intakes might increase the risk of heart disease and prostate cancer. Very high levels in your blood and urine can cause poor muscle tone, poor kidney function, low phosphate levels, constipation, nausea, weight loss, extreme tiredness, frequent need to urinate, abnormal heart rhythms, and a high risk of death from heart disease [NIH ODS] [FDA data].

Our recommendation

We recommend you start by reviewing your total calcium intake from food and other supplements. Be aware that calcium can reduce the absorption of several medications, including bisphosphonates, tetracycline antibiotics, fluoroquinolone antibiotics, levothyroxine, and phenytoin [NIH ODS]. Speak with your doctor before starting this supplement, especially if you take any of these medications or have a history of heart or kidney issues.

How to Read This Label

Supplement labels contain several key sections regulated by the FDA:

  • Serving Size — The recommended amount per dose. Always check this — some products require multiple capsules per serving.
  • Amount Per Serving — Shows the quantity of each nutrient in the product, typically in IU (International Units), mg (milligrams), or mcg (micrograms).
  • % Daily Value (%DV) — Indicates how much a nutrient in a serving contributes to a daily diet. 5% DV or less is low; 20% DV or more is high.
  • Other Ingredients — Lists inactive ingredients like fillers, binders, and capsule materials (e.g., gelatin, cellulose, magnesium stearate).
  • Suggested Use — The manufacturer's recommended directions for taking the supplement, including timing and dosage.
